St Johnstone 1-0 Livingston

SFL

Collin Samuel's late strike got First Division leaders St Johnstone out of jail as they beat Livingston despite a poor home performance.

The Saints goal led a charmed life in the first half with keeper Alan Main saved by the woodwork.

Derek Holmes went close for Saints, but it took 70 minutes for a serious challenge on goal.

Chris Millar found Samuel with a chip and the striker chested the ball down before blasting in the winner.
